As an Account Executive your main task will be to provide support to new and existing accommodation partners, contacting, informing and advising them about how to meet the demands of the visitors on the Booking.com website. You will also build the hotel webpages and train the new hotels on how to use Booking.com’s extranet and how to use the systems that can improve their availability and supply.
This is a full-time position located in our Montreal Canada Office
